Summary: | The system uninterruptible power supply with an output voltage sine wave used several parallel-connected uninterruptible power supplies. In the linearized model output inverter delay is not taken into account the phase of the output signal pulse - width modulator. To account for the delay unit uses a standard Simulink - Transport Delay. Optimization of the transition function performed by a function block Signal Constraint. As a result, the coefficients found PID - regulator system inverter control. |
